Stripe is a financial infrastructure company founded in 2010 by the Irish brothers Patrick and John Collison, dual-headquartered in South San Francisco and Dublin. Its APIs let businesses accept payments, run marketplaces, issue cards, manage subscriptions and handle tax and compliance without building banking integrations themselves, and it processes well over a trillion dollars of volume a year for customers ranging from startups to the largest technology companies. Beyond payments the company has expanded into treasury and issuing, revenue and finance automation, stablecoin infrastructure through its Bridge acquisition, and fraud prevention powered by its own machine learning models.

About the team

  • The Mission: Lead the engineering team building the Requirements Management API and infrastructure that enables Stripe to collect, explain, track, and resolve risk requirements throughout the user lifecycle from onboarding through ongoing monitoring. This work makes Risk reusable across products, markets, and user types, while helping Stripe expand regulated financial products without rebuilding compliance and risk workflows for each new use case.
  • The Scale: The team’s interfaces and standards influence how requirements are created and fulfilled across Risk, Onboarding, and product integrations-not just a single product experience. This requires broad cross-team influence across 6+ teams. It is currently 6 people and actively hiring.
  • The Complexity: This role has technical complexity in both API design and system scalability / reliability. The underlying system is used broadly across all of Stripe, serves a high volume of traffic, and has critical SLOs backing meaningful user-facing APIs. The role also requires strong product judgment: translating risk-management needs into reusable APIs that work for Risk teams while delivering clear, effective remediation experiences for Stripe users.
  • The Stakeholders: Partner with Risk Engineering teams, Onboarding, Product, Data Science, and product teams integrating with the platform. You will align decisioning, information-collection, and user-facing presentation experiences around consistent, explainable requirements.
